Output ddb7c389693865e0306331237344e2ebfa57600e1128456b9f38fa7f19f3a678:0

value
1899990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afdb54152e5e36c3d570779d8385e9a91eb00b3 OP_EQUAL
address
3Qa8nSiVDDMpUzirh34WJQwv4qbKnC2BFi
transaction
ddb7c389693865e0306331237344e2ebfa57600e1128456b9f38fa7f19f3a678
spent
true